Golby Run (Pine Creek tributary)

Golby Run is a 1.37 mi (2.20 km) long tributary to Pine Creek in Warren County and Venango Counties, Pennsylvania.

Course

Golby Run rises about 0.5 miles northeast of Pleasantville, Pennsylvania in Venango County and then flows north into Warren County to Pine Creek about 0.5 miles east of Enterprise, Pennsylvania.[2]

Watershed

Golby Run drains 2.28 square miles (5.9 km2) of area, receives about 44.8 in/year of precipitation, and has a wetness index of 434.35 and is about 87% forested.[4]
